2001 Eagle Vision vs. 2013 Kia RIO
To start off, 2013 Kia RIO is newer by 12 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 Eagle Vision.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 Eagle Vision would be higher. At 2,700 cc (6 cylinders), 2001 Eagle Vision is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2001 Eagle Vision (197 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 61 more horse power than 2013 Kia RIO. (136 HP @ 6300 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2001 Eagle Vision should accelerate faster than 2013 Kia RIO.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2001 Eagle Vision weights approximately 355 kg more than 2013 Kia RIO.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
